Areas Requiring Caution
No single asset is a silver bullet, and there are situations where the Pumpkin Everything Autumn Turkey T-Shirt requires careful handling. I would advise against using it in very small sizes, such as favicons or tiny social media avatars, as the typographic details may become muddy. Similarly, in crowded layouts with competing elements, this design can overwhelm the viewer. It demands space to breathe.
Furthermore, if your brand identity leans toward ultra-minimalist or corporate professionalism, this asset might feel too casual. It lacks the stark, clean lines often associated with high-end tech or finance branding. In such cases, it is better suited for supporting brand elements rather than primary logo usage. Always test the asset on light and dark backgrounds to ensure sufficient contrast, especially if you are using it for digital ads where visibility is key.
Technical Considerations for Designers
Before integrating any creative design element into a paid client project, technical due diligence is non-negotiable. Here are the steps I took to ensure the Pumpkin Everything Autumn Turkey T-Shirt met professional standards:
- File Format Inspection: I verified that the SVG file was editable. This allowed me to adjust the kerning slightly to fit specific label dimensions and change colors to match the client’s exact Pantone codes. Having an editable vector file is essential for modern design workflows.
- Transparency Check: I reviewed the PNG versions to ensure the transparency channels were clean. Artifacts around the edges of the turkey illustration can ruin a printable design if not caught early.
- Contrast Testing: I placed the design over both white and black backgrounds to check readability. The orange tones popped well against dark backgrounds, creating a striking visual impact suitable for evening-focused marketing campaigns.
- Licensing Verification: Most importantly, I confirmed the commercial license terms. Using this asset for a client’s merchandise required a commercial-grade license, which ensured we were protected against copyright issues. This is a critical step for any small business owner or agency.
